Ingredients

  • 1 Betty Crocker Yellow cake mix

  • 1 cup/200gm sour cream

  • 2 eggs

  • 3/4 cup oil

  • 2 tbsp roughly chopped walnuts or slivered almonds

  • 2 tbsp brown sugar

  • 2 tbsp honey

  • 1 tbsp cinnamon powder

Directions

  • Pre-heat the oven to 180C.
  • Prepare the batter with cake mix, oil, eggs and sour cream.
  • Sprinkle toppings (brown sugar, nuts, honey and cinnamon).
  • Swirl with a butter knife or back of a spoon.
  • Bake for roughly 25 mins or until inserted toothpick comes out clean.
